A couple of days ago one of my buyer clients asked what efflorescence is.  We saw that word on several St. Paul truth in housing inspection reports. “efflorescence noted near wash tub”

Efflorescence occurs in masonry construction, particularly brick, when water moving through a wall or other structure brings natural salts to the surface. When the water evaporates the resulting white deposits are commonly referred to as “efflorescence”.
